Tengo una hoja_1 con 2 columnas:
ea
COL_A COL_B
ITM_RRT_Transaction_Status Y/N
C991, no hay alarma del administrador orion Y/N
.....
Intento completar COL_B basándose en una tabla de referencia en la hoja_2 (coincide en ambos COL_A)
COL_A COL_B
ITM_RRT Y
no alarm N
entonces el valor de la hoja_2.COL_A puede estar en cualquier lugar dentro de la hoja_1.COL_A,
¿cómo puedo hacerlo?
gracias por la ayuda
Respuesta1
Para Vlookup(x,y,TRUE
, su tabla de búsqueda debe serordenado ascendentetrabajar. Así es como ocurre con la TRUE
búsqueda en v.
No sé por qué ha cambiado la página de ayuda de vlookup, peroaquíen la página vlookup, si hace clic en "detalles técnicos"
range_lookup (opcional)
Un valor lógico que especifica si desea que BUSCARV encuentre una coincidencia aproximada o exacta:
VERDADERO supone que la primera columna de la tabla está ordenada numérica o alfabéticamente y luego buscará el valor más cercano. Este es el método predeterminado si no especifica ninguno.
FALSO busca el valor exacto en la primera columna.
Se puede ver mejor enBUSCARH:
Si range_lookup es VERDADERO, los valores en la primera fila de table_array deben colocarse en orden ascendente: ...-2, -1, 0, 1, 2,... , AZ, FALSE, TRUE; de lo contrario, es posible que BUSCARH no proporcione el valor correcto. Si range_lookup es FALSO, no es necesario ordenar table_array.
También está presente en elBUSCARpágina.
También tenga en cuenta que lo mismo se aplica a MATCH
with type: 1
. Y un MATCH
with type: -1
requiere que la lista seaordenado descendente.
Sólo coincidencias exactasse puede encontrar desdelistas sin ordenar.